Transaction 51345d49798512fdb5f23fcc7cd52f65386f975914940915a12d23b6fc59e008
1 Input
2 Outputs
- 51345d49798512fdb5f23fcc7cd52f65386f975914940915a12d23b6fc59e008:0
- 51345d49798512fdb5f23fcc7cd52f65386f975914940915a12d23b6fc59e008:1
value 61975054
address 125WvmCm6UosFCB14aRgkG61YvLxWAHZsp
value 41272800
address 1KpDcAVGnik4n5D9mHDgCcymQJu4QtgtPc